Description

Monaco Classic Mai Tai 355ML is a ready-to-drink canned cocktail that blends light and dark rum with orange curaçao and tropical fruit flavors at 9% ABV in a 355ml (12 oz) can. With the equivalent of two full shots packed into each can, it delivers noticeably more punch than most RTD competitors in the category.

Quick Facts: ABV: 9%  |  Origin: Cold Spring, Minnesota, USA  |  Style: Ready-to-Drink Canned Cocktail  |  Producer: Atomic Brands (House of Monaco)

Production & Heritage

Monaco is produced by Atomic Brands and bottled at their facility in Cold Spring, Minnesota. The brand has built a reputation in the RTD space by focusing on higher-ABV canned cocktails that prioritize flavor intensity over subtlety. The Classic Mai Tai expression combines light and dark rum with orange curaçao and tropical fruit juices, then carbonates the blend lightly before canning — a departure from the still, shaken format of a traditional tiki bar Mai Tai, but one that gives the drink a refreshing effervescence.

Tasting Notes

Aroma: Tropical fruit jumps from the can immediately, with sweet pineapple and citrus zest leading the way. A faint rum undertone anchors the nose beneath the fruit-forward top notes.

Taste: The entry is decidedly sweet and fruity, drawing frequent comparisons to Hawaiian Punch among consumer reviewers. Mid-palate, hints of orange curaçao and a light rum warmth emerge, adding modest depth. The overall profile leans toward the sweeter end of the spectrum, prioritizing tropical vibrancy over the nutty, orgeat-driven complexity of a classic bar Mai Tai.

Finish: The finish is relatively short, with lingering tropical sweetness and a touch of citrus zest. Light carbonation lifts the aftertaste and keeps the drink feeling crisp rather than cloying.

How to Drink Monaco Mai Tai

The most straightforward serve is straight from the chilled can or poured over ice in a rocks glass, which tempers some of the sweetness as the ice dilutes. While this is designed as a complete cocktail, it also works as a mixer or base in more elaborate drinks. Try it as the rum component in a Jungle Bird riff, where adding a splash of Campari and fresh lime offsets the sweetness with welcome bitterness. It can extend a Rum Punch bowl at summer gatherings, contributing both alcohol and tropical flavor without additional mixing. For a frozen option, pour the can into a blender with ice for an instant Frozen Mai Tai slushie that requires zero bartending skill.

Frequently Asked Questions

What does Monaco Mai Tai taste like? Monaco Mai Tai is a sweet, tropical, fruit-forward canned cocktail with prominent pineapple and citrus flavors, light carbonation, and a warm rum backbone. Consumer reviewers frequently compare the overall flavor profile to Hawaiian Punch with an alcoholic kick.

How does Monaco Mai Tai compare to Cutwater Tiki Rum Mai Tai? Both are RTD Mai Tai-style canned cocktails, but Monaco comes in at 9% ABV with noticeable carbonation and a sweeter tropical profile, while Cutwater Tiki Rum Mai Tai is made with their own pot-distilled rum and aims for a more spirit-forward, traditional Mai Tai character. The choice often comes down to whether you prefer a fruitier, effervescent drink or a more rum-dominant one.

Is Monaco Mai Tai good for beginners? Yes — its sweet, fruity flavor and approachable carbonation make it an easy entry point for anyone new to rum-based cocktails or the RTD category in general. The sweetness effectively masks the 9% ABV, so newcomers should be mindful of pacing.

Where is Monaco Mai Tai made? Monaco Mai Tai is produced by Atomic Brands and bottled at their facility in Cold Spring, Minnesota. Despite the brand's Mediterranean-inspired name, all production takes place in the United States.

What foods pair well with Monaco Mai Tai? Its tropical sweetness pairs naturally with spicy dishes like jerk chicken or Thai red curry, where the sugar tempers heat. Grilled shrimp skewers and coconut-crusted fish complement the rum and citrus notes. For dessert, try it alongside mango sticky rice or a coconut panna cotta for a full tiki-inspired pairing.

What sizes does Monaco Mai Tai come in? Monaco Classic Mai Tai is available in single 355ml (12 oz) cans and in variety packs that include other Monaco cocktail flavors.
